Georgia Payroll Employment By County for The Private Accommodation And Food Services Industry in July, 2019
Updated on January 9, 2024.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in July, 2019, Georgia added -2,052 number of jobs to the private accommodation and food services industry. Among Georgia counties, Fulton added the highest number of jobs (251), followed by Cherokee (147), and White (110).
